Hi,

I have problem with SCO link over Mobidick BDU33A , after 1-3 minutes
established connection adapter may restart. 
My configuration:

hciconfig hci0 -a
hci0:   Type: USB
        BD Address: xx:xx:xx:xx:xx:xx ACL MTU: 384:8 SCO MTU: 64:8
        UP RUNNING PSCAN ISCAN
        RX bytes:101 acl:0 sco:0 events:13 errors:0
        TX bytes:300 acl:0 sco:0 commands:13 errors:0
        Features: 0xff 0xff 0x8f 0xfe 0x9b 0xf9 0x00 0x80
        Packet type: DM1 DM3 DM5 DH1 DH3 DH5 HV1 HV2 HV3
        Link policy: RSWITCH HOLD SNIFF PARK
        Link mode: SLAVE ACCEPT
        Name: 'Bluez-0'
        Class: 0x200404
        Service Classes: Audio
        Device Class: Audio/Video, Device conforms to the Headset
profile
        HCI Ver: 2.0 (0x3) HCI Rev: 0x6e6 LMP Ver: 2.0 (0x3) LMP Subver:
0x6e6
        Manufacturer: Cambridge Silicon Radio (10)

# hciconfig hci0 revision
hci0:   Type: USB
        BD Address: xx:xx:xx:xx:xx:xx ACL MTU: 384:8 SCO MTU: 64:8
        Build 1766
        Chip version: BlueCore4-External
        Max key size: 56 bit
        SCO mapping:  HCI

# hciconfig hci0 voice
hci0:   Type: USB
        BD Address: xx:xx:xx:xx:xx:xx ACL MTU: 384:8 SCO MTU: 64:8
        Voice setting: 0x0060 (Default Condition)
        Input Coding: Linear
        Input Data Format: 2's complement
        Input Sample Size: 16 bit
        # of bits padding at MSB: 0
        Air Coding Format: CVSD


Kernel 2.6.17.7 with patch from bluez.org

Latest libs & utils.

Howto fix this problem?
